Petition
Ban bottom trawling in Marine Protected Areas and protect 30% of UK sea
Rejected
10 signatures
What the petition asks
Fully ban bottom-towed fishing gear in all UK Marine Protected Areas. Enforce protections and expand them to cover at least 30% of UK waters by 2030, in line with the UK’s global environmental commitments
Bottom trawling destroys seabed habitats, releases carbon, and harms marine biodiversity. Over 90% of UK Marine Protected Areas still allow it. The UK has pledged to protect 30% of oceans by 2030, but most MPAs lack effective enforcement. We need real action: ban bottom-towed gear in all MPAs and extend proper protection to 30% of UK seas. This will help restore marine life, cut carbon emissions, and support sustainable fishing and coastal communities.
